A second person has drowned while trying to enter the US illegally in Eagle Pass, Texas, a day after a three-year-old boy died while 10,000 migrants rushed to get into the border town. Details of the second drowning on Thursday remain unclear. FOX News reports the person drowned this morning, as Customs and Border Patrol agents raced to keep up with the influx. Since Wednesday morning, an astonishing 10,000 migrants have entered Eagle Pass, a small border town of fewer than 30,000. Most have been released after being processed.
